
In Hyderabad's Meerpet area, a 20-year-old BSc student named Himabindu took her own life by consuming poison after the sudden death of her adopted pet cat. Police have registered a case and are investigating the incident, with the body sent for post-mortem examination. Neighbors described her as quiet and studious, and authorities are exploring all factors while acknowledging the emotional distress caused by the pet's loss.
